Key Responsibilities
1. Business & Systems Analysis
  • Review, analyze, and evaluate business systems and user needs to formulate systems that parallel overall business strategies
  • Apply experience in business process reengineering and identify new applications of technology to make business more effective
  • Prepare solution options, risk identification, and financial analyses such as cost/benefit, ROI, and buy/build evaluations
  • Write detailed descriptions of user needs, program functions, and steps required to develop or modify computer programs
2. CARE System Migration Support
  • Provide business and systems analysis in support of the retirement of the Client Assignment and Registration (CARE) system and migration of legacy components to future applications
  • Support the transition of CARE functions from a legacy mainframe environment into modern, modular, Medicaid Enterprise System-aligned solutions
  • Ensure smooth migration of CARE-related business, data, reporting, and integration capabilities from current to future locations
  • Work across business, application, data, reporting, infrastructure, security, and project delivery teams to document current-state business and technical processes
3. Requirements Management & Traceability
  • Elicit, document, validate, and manage requirements; facilitate collaboration to synthesize information and ensure full coverage
  • Build traceability from stakeholder needs to system requirements; challenge gaps and validate assumptions for accuracy
  • Translate complex business processes, screens, and data flows into clear, testable, traceable, and technically actionable requirements
  • Write and maintain business process flow diagrams and visuals
4. Stakeholder Collaboration & Gap Analysis
  • Serve as a bridge between business, application, data, reporting, infrastructure, security, and project delivery teams
  • Facilitate discovery and analysis of CARE functions; synthesize findings and deliver decision-ready analysis
  • Map business and technical dependencies, identify gaps, and work with stakeholders to define future-state requirements
  • Proactively address gaps and validate assumptions across cross-functional teams
5. Medicaid Operations Continuity
  • Ensure CARE retirement covers all critical dependencies through cross-functional reviews and actionable recommendations
  • Support continuity of Medicaid operations throughout the migration process
  • Define future-state business and technical requirements aligned with Medicaid Enterprise System standards
